Recent Powerball winners
The winning numbers from the last drawing on Saturday, Feb. 15 were 16 – 32 – 35 – 36 – 46 with a powerball of 03. The multiplier was 3x.
While no one claimed the jackpot or the million-dollar prize for matching all five white balls, 11 people matched four white balls and the powerball.
That prize is worth $50,000 but three of the winners upped their prize to $150,000 as they had the 3x multiplier in play.
The last jackpot hit last Wednesday, when a player from Michigan claimed the estimated $70 million prize. Before that, a Florida player hit when it was up to $396.9 million. The jackpot had rolled over 24 times to build to nearly $400 million.
